Rent & eviction protection

Is 3650 18Th St rent-controlled?

San Francisco's Rent Ordinance caps rent increases and provides eviction protection for most residential units built before 1979 with 2+ units. Here's how this building scores.

Not rent-controlled. Buildings constructed after 1978 are generally exempt from SF rent increase limits under the Costa-Hawkins Act.

Based on SF Assessor records. Not legal advice — confirm with the SF Rent Board.

Initial analysis

The 6-unit multi-family residential building at 3650 18th Street in Mission Dolores, owned by Walter & Diana Wong Family, was constructed in 2003 following the demolition of a two-story office building that occurred in 2001-2002. The four-story building's construction included essential safety systems, with fire system installation and life safety tests completed between 2002 and 2003. The building has undergone several inspections and compliance checks over the years, with the most recent inspections in 2022-2023 noting no violations, though compliance affidavits were required. Notable violations in 2005 and 2011 related to fire safety equipment, including fire extinguishers and alarm systems, were promptly addressed and abated.

The property has experienced periodic maintenance and compliance issues, particularly regarding fire safety systems and interior surfaces. In 2011, there were multiple violations concerning water damage, damaged ceilings, and egress obstructions, all of which were resolved. A 2003 complaint about potential facade issues was investigated but ultimately resolved. The building's permit history shows standard development activities, including street space permits in 2002 and 2011. Recent 311 calls from 2023-2024 primarily relate to street-level issues such as parking violations and sanitation concerns, which are more relevant to the immediate neighborhood than the building itself. Two withdrawn planning proposals related to height modifications were submitted in the past, but they are no longer active.

How 3650 18Th St's risk score is calculated

We trained a model on 7 years of SF DBI inspection data — notice of violation filings, complaint history, and owner track records. It estimates the probability that DBI inspectors will issue a Notice of Violation at this address in the next 12 months. Lower % = safer.

What the score means for you

Grade A–B — Low risk

DBI rarely finds violations here. Strong maintenance history and a clean complaint record.

Grade C — Moderate risk

Some past violations or complaints on record. Worth asking the landlord about any open issues before signing.

Grade D–F — High risk

Elevated violation and complaint history. DBI has found issues here before and is statistically likely to again.
